Me again, hehe... Here's some info one Maria from that Yevshan site, where you can buy her stuff on cd:

"Maria Burmaka presents a more pop-oriented set of songs and ballads. Her delicate vocals are accompanied by guitar, percussion and violin. Arrangements are very interesting, somewhat reminiscent of the "Enya" style and provide fine easy-listening material. Contains: Rozliuby, De ty teper, Tykha voda, Povernutys' nazad, and more... A new sound for this young artist!"
